function wpcf_admin_menu_user_fields_control_hook_helper() { do_action('wpcf_admin_page_init'); // add_action( 'admin_head', 'wpcf_admin_user_fields_control_js' ); require_once WPCF_INC_ABSPATH . '/fields.php'; require_once WPCF_EMBEDDED_INC_ABSPATH . '/fields.php'; require_once WPCF_INC_ABSPATH . '/fields-control.php'; if (true && isset($_REQUEST['_wpnonce']) && wp_verify_nonce($_REQUEST['_wpnonce'], 'user_fields_control_bulk') && (isset($_POST['action']) || isset($_POST['action2'])) && !empty($_POST['fields'])) { $action = $_POST['action'] == '-1' ? sanitize_text_field($_POST['action2']) : sanitize_text_field($_POST['action']); wpcf_admin_user_fields_control_bulk_actions($action); } /** * add common resources */ wpcf_fields_contol_common_resources(); /** * Table class. */ wpcf_admin_page_add_options('ufc', __('Usermeta Fields', 'wpcf')); global $wpcf_control_table; $wpcf_control_table = new Types_Admin_Usermeta_Control_Table(); $wpcf_control_table->prepare_items(); }
/** * Add Usermeta Fields manager page. * * @author Gen gen.i@icanlocalize.com * @since Types 1.3 */ function wpcf_admin_menu_user_fields_control_hook() { do_action('wpcf_admin_page_init'); add_action('admin_head', 'wpcf_admin_user_fields_control_js'); add_thickbox(); require_once WPCF_INC_ABSPATH . '/fields.php'; require_once WPCF_EMBEDDED_INC_ABSPATH . '/fields.php'; require_once WPCF_INC_ABSPATH . '/fields-control.php'; require_once WPCF_INC_ABSPATH . '/usermeta-control.php'; if (isset($_REQUEST['_wpnonce']) && wp_verify_nonce($_REQUEST['_wpnonce'], 'user_fields_control_bulk') && (isset($_POST['action']) || isset($_POST['action2'])) && !empty($_POST['fields'])) { $action = $_POST['action'] == '-1' ? sanitize_text_field($_POST['action2']) : sanitize_text_field($_POST['action']); wpcf_admin_user_fields_control_bulk_actions($action); } global $wpcf_control_table; $wpcf_control_table = new WPCF_User_Fields_Control_Table(array('ajax' => true, 'singular' => __('User Field', 'wpcf'), 'plural' => __('User Fields', 'wpcf'))); $wpcf_control_table->prepare_items(); }